Output 8088325eaafb189a0589fba89015a6443c4b77d8cd8657c45f800d57896e9841:0

value
7529684
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 65c85c54f4062cb618dae1f06c27d517393a0680 OP_EQUALVERIFY OP_CHECKSIG
address
1AHBGgM38FutxDuxCC5TBv8XyNHjJP9XHM
transaction
8088325eaafb189a0589fba89015a6443c4b77d8cd8657c45f800d57896e9841
spent
true